Battery system
Abstract
A main object of the present disclosure is to provide a battery system capable of avoiding an over charge with a simple sensor element. The present disclosure achieves the object by providing a battery system comprising: a battery module including a battery pack A including a plurality of battery cells connected in series, and a battery pack B including a plurality of battery cells connected in series, connected in parallel, a monitoring unit configured to monitor a condition of the battery module, and a control unit configured to control at least a charge of the battery module, and the monitoring unit includes: a first current sensor configured to measure a total current IA of the battery pack A, and a second current sensor configured to measure a total current IB of the battery pack B, and the control unit includes: a calculating section configured to calculate a determining value based on the total current IA and the total current IB, and a determining section configured to determine an occurrence of an over charge based on the determining value.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A method for determining an occurrence of an over charge for a battery module, wherein the battery module includes a battery pack A including a plurality of battery cells connected in series, and a battery pack B including a plurality of battery cells connected in series, and the battery pack A and the battery pack B are connected in parallel,
